Multinational - SADC: Regional Harmonization of Regulatory Frameworks and Tools for Improved Electricity Regulation in SADC
Detail:
The Regional Harmonization of Regulatory Frameworks and Tools for Improved Electricity Regulation in SADC is a regional initiative designed to enhance the sustainability of the regional electricity sector through effective, uniform, and transparent regulatory frameworks that set out clear principles, rules, processes and standards for the SADC region. The main objective is to harmonise regulatory frameworks to facilitate electricity trading within SADC, a Regional Economic Community comprising 16 Member States. A combination of studies, capacity building and development of tools will be undertaken to realise these main objectives. The project comprises four main components: (i) Elaboration and Adoption of Regional Electricity Regulatory Principles (RERP) and Key Performance Indicators for RERA; (ii) Expansion of Regional Utility Key Performance Indicators (UKPI); (iii) Harmonised Comparison of Electricity Tariffs (HCET) and Cost Reflectivity Assessment Framework Tool (CRAFT); (iv) Development of Energy Information and Database Management System (EIDBMS). A final component will cover Program Management which will be co-financed with RERA Secretariat. The project is designed as a three-year programme and will be financed from ADF Grant Resources. The project budget net of taxes and duties is UA 857,000 (USD 1.2 million).
